Maximo Open Forum

 View Only
  • 1.  Adding Message Tracking for Web Services Incoming Interface

    Posted 07-27-2023 20:46

    Hi guys:  I've been trying to add Message Tracking for an incoming Web Services PO interface from the financial system.  We have it turned on for the Enterprise Service, but we're not getting any data.  On looking at the IBM KB, I notice this article:  Enabling Message Tracking for incoming Web Service calls

    Ibm remove preview
    Enabling Message Tracking for incoming Web Service calls
    How to track incoming Web Service calls
    View this on Ibm >

    So I can make this change, but I'm wondering whether this update would have other consequences.  Does anyone know?

    Also:  what I REALLY want to catch are those POs that Maximo failed to process, and the ideal situation is that Maximo stores the payload for the failed PO messages.  Can anyone verify that once I enable this functionality, I will be able to do that?

    TIA


    #Integrations

    ------------------------------
    Shannon Rotz
    InComm Solutions Inc.
    ------------------------------


  • 2.  RE: Adding Message Tracking for Web Services Incoming Interface

    Posted 07-28-2023 00:57

    Hi Shannon,

    This works when webservices are using queues. Yes, you will get POs that maximo failed to Process and the payload. 

    1. Enable message Tracking in enterprise Service application, for your PO enterprise service
    2. Click on "Store Message"
    3. You can also provide a Search ID (like ponum) for better tracking of your message.
    4. Ensure "Bypass Queue" has been unchecked for the Web services.

    Good Day.



    ------------------------------
    Subhransu Sekhar Sahoo
    Tata Consultancy Services
    ------------------------------



  • 3.  RE: Adding Message Tracking for Web Services Incoming Interface

    Posted 07-28-2023 01:10

    Hi Subhransu - thanks for confirming - this is going to make my day!  Lol. 

    There are no other consequences to setting the Bypass Queue to 0, correct?

     

     

     

     



    ------------------------------
    Shannon Rotz
    InComm Solutions Inc.
    ------------------------------



  • 4.  RE: Adding Message Tracking for Web Services Incoming Interface

    Posted 07-28-2023 01:35

    Hi Shannon, 

    The webservice call will become asynchronous once you uncheck that checkbox. 

    Asynchronous means the external system establishes and maintains a connection until the message is passed into a JMS queue. 



    ------------------------------
    Subhransu Sekhar Sahoo
    PriceWaterHouseCoopers Services Pvt Ltd
    ------------------------------